Full Journal pdf1994-03-29 House Journal Page 3059 HB 330 The following, which advanced to third reading from the March 28, 1994, calendar (page 3018), was read the third time: CS F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 330(TRA) "An Act relating to the use of natural gas as a motor vehicle fuel in state-owned vehicles and to the Department of Transportation and Public Facilities' authority to participate in joint ventures related to natural gas." Representative Hoffman moved and asked unanimous consent that he be allowed to abstain from voting due to a possible conflict of interest. Objection was heard, and Representative Hoffman was required to vote. 1994-03-29 House Journal Page 3060 HB 330 The question being: "Shall CSHB 330(TRA) pass the House?" The roll was taken with the following result: CSHB 330(TRA) Third Reading Final Passage YEAS: 36 NAYS: 2 EXCUSED: 0 ABSENT: 2 Yeas: Barnes, Brice, Brown, Bunde, Carney, Davies, B.Davis, G.Davis, Finkelstein, Foster, Green, Grussendorf, Hanley, Hoffman, Hudson, James, Kott, Larson, Mackie, MacLean, Martin, Menard, Mulder, Nicholia, Nordlund, Olberg, Parnell, Phillips, Porter, Sanders, Therriault, Toohey, Ulmer, Vezey, Williams, Willis Nays: Navarre, Sitton Absent: Davidson, Moses Navarre changed from "Yea" to "Nay". And so, CSHB 330(TRA) passed the House. Representative Navarre later gave notice of reconsideration of his vote on CSHB 330(TRA), and the reconsideration was taken up then.
